The Tasheel series is esteemed because it was developed by scholars who recognized the need for an invigorating and authentic Islamic curriculum in modern society. With over 70 years of combined experience in traditional Islamic scholarship and education, the Jamiatul Ulama South Africa created this series to be engaging and easily digestible for modern learners.
